Which side of the plane to sit from Liuting Airport (Qingdao) to Tunxi International Airport (Huangshan)?
Right Side of the Plane
The right side offers a superior view of the inland geography, including the distant silhouette of Mount Tai and a spectacular approach to the iconic granite peaks of the Yellow Mountains.
Qingdao Urban Landscape
A final look at the red-tiled roofs and modern skyscrapers of the coastal city.
Mount Tai
On clear days, the distant but distinct silhouette of China's most sacred mountain is visible to the west.
Anhui Plains
Intricate patchworks of agricultural fields and the winding Huai River network.
Chao Lake
A massive freshwater lake near Hefei that provides a beautiful landmark during the mid-flight phase.
Yellow Mountain Massif
The dramatic, jagged granite peaks of Huangshan appearing during the final descent phase.
The right side is premier for the approach into Tunxi. For afternoon flights, you may witness a stunning sunset over the mountain ranges. Try to book a seat ahead of the wing for an unobstructed view of the peaks as the plane maneuvers for landing.
Jiaozhou Bay Bridge
View of the massive T-shaped cross-sea bridge shortly after takeoff from Qingdao.
Yellow Sea Coastline
Aerial perspective of the coastline stretching south toward Lianyungang.
Hongze Lake
One of China's largest freshwater lakes appearing as a vast blue expanse in the Jiangsu plains.
Yangtze River Crossing
Crossing the industrial and scenic lifeline of China near the Nanjing corridor.
Anhui Bamboo Forests
Lush green rolling hills typical of southern Anhui during the descent into Huangshan.
Morning flights are best for the left side to avoid the harsh glare of the western sun. Keep your camera ready immediately after takeoff to catch the intricate patterns of the Jiaozhou Bay aquaculture farms and the bridge structure.
